Transport minister blames islanders – Morrison

Labour challenger accuses transport minister of blaming islanders not MP and MSP

Parliamentary candidate Alasdair Morrison said he was “disgusted” to read comments by Derek MacKay, the Islands and Transport Minister, where he blamed islanders for the shambles surrounding the procurement of the ferry the Loch Seaforth.

Transport minister Derek Mackay

Alasdair Morrison said: “It’s shameful that the Transport Minister, Derek MacKay, arrives in Benbecula to blame islanders for his Government’s shambolic procurement of the Loch Seaforth. Why he launched this attack about islanders on Lewis on a visit to Uist is difficult to fathom. Uist has many ferry issues which need resolving without Mr MacKay wasting time berating people on a neighbouring island.

“It’s hugely revealing that Mr MacKay criticised harbour trusts, Comhairle nan Eilean Siar, CalMac and CMAL but did not apportion any blame to the MP and MSP. Mr MacKay should apologise for his Government’s neglect and the absence of our MP and MSP. They are to blame not innocent bystanders.

“I also hope that the leadership of Comhairle nan Eilean Siar will rebut this slur immediately and remind the Minister that they, and many others, told the SNP Government that Lewis needed a two-ferry solution not the half baked solution they are inflicting on our communities.”
